Description

Step back into the golden age of rock 'n' roll with the Rickenbacker 425V63, a tribute to the iconic models that shaped the sound of the 1960s. This solid body electric guitar captures the essence of vintage Rickenbacker instruments, offering modern playability while celebrating classic design and craftsmanship. The 425V63 is a meticulous reproduction of the 1963 model, ensuring it stays true to its roots with a distinctive single-pickup configuration and a sleek, minimalist appeal.

Crafted with an all-maple body and neck, the 425V63 provides a bright, punchy tone that cuts through any mix, making it ideal for both rhythm and lead playing. The proprietary "Toaster Top" pickup is a standout feature, delivering that unmistakable jangle and chime Rickenbacker is famous for, while the vintage-style tailpiece adds both aesthetic charm and functional reliability.

A rosewood fingerboard provides a smooth playing experience, and the vintage-style tuners ensure stable tuning and classic looks. Whether you're a collector, performer, or both, the Rickenbacker 425V63 offers a perfect blend of historical significance and modern reliability, capturing the spirit of an era while standing the test of time.

Product specs

Brand Rickenbacker
Model 425V63
Year 1999
Made In United States
Categories Solid Body Electric Guitars
Body Material Maple
Body Shape Double Cutaway
Body Type Solid Body
Bridge/Tailpiece Type Top-Load
Color Family Black, Red
Finish Features Matching Headstock
Finish Style Gloss
Fretboard Material Rosewood
Fretboard Radius 12"
Model Family Rickenbacker 425
Model Sub-Family Rickenbacker 425V63
Neck Construction Neck-Through
Neck Material Maple
Number of Frets 24
Number of Strings 6-String
Offset Body Non-Offset Body
Pickup Configuration SS
Right / Left Handed Left Handed
Series Rickenbacker Combo 400 Series
